    Bridging the Gap Between Restaurant Tech and Operations

    Often, hospitality tech solutions are brought to market with the best of intentions – to help reduce inefficiencies, cut costs, or enhance guest experience. The problem is that many software engineers and tech executives lack an understanding of how the end-user will actually utilize their systems in a high-pressure restaurant environment. Todd Vahlsing understands both the tech and the inner workings of restaurant operations, having led teams on the ground and implemented new technologies at restaurant franchises. He bridges the gap between restaurant tech and operations by helping tech companies bring their solutions to market and assisting restaurants in smoothly integrating new technologies into their workflows.   Join us for an insightful episode with Todd Vahlsing, founder and principal consultant at BridgePoint Ops, who brings over 35 years of hands-on expertise in restaurant operations and enterprise technology.    Rising from behind-the-counter beginnings at McDonald’s to leading tech strategy at PAR Technology and spearheading AI-driven innovation at Nomad Go, Todd uniquely understands both sides of hospitality. He’s mastered how to scale effective solutions that serve operators and vendors alike—with real empathy and a deep sense of what really works.    In this conversation, we explore how Todd demystifies emerging restaurant tech solutions. We discussed what makes restaurant technology solutions, such as POS systems, credit card processing, loyalty programs, and QR codes succeed or fail, AI, and the future of restaurant tech. Todd also shared his strategies for adopting new technology and enabling seamless operational change, which preserves the people-first spirit that keeps restaurants—and their owners—thriving.     How UrVenue is Transforming Hospitality

    In this episode, we sit down with Rebecca Salvador, Account Executive at UrVenue, to explore how their innovative technology is transforming the hospitality experience. Rebecca shares how UrVenue helps hotels connect guests with on-property amenities, restaurants, and events, while also offering tools like 3D renderings to design and optimize spaces. From streamlining operations to enhancing the guest journey, Rebecca explains how UrVenue is shaping the future of hotel and event technology. UrVenue is a comprehensive hospitality technology platform designed to enhance the guest experience and streamline operations for venues such as hotels, resorts, nightclubs, dayclubs, bars, lounges, and mixed-use entertainment spaces. Their flagship product, UV Enterprise, serves as a Property Experience Management System (PXMS), enabling venues to manage and monetize non-room inventory like dining, events, and activities.  Key features of UrVenue include: Unified Booking Cart: Guests can book various experiences—such as dining, spa treatments, and events—through a single, integrated platform. 3D Interactive Maps: These maps allow guests to visualize and select specific locations, like VIP tables or cabanas, enhancing their booking experience. Itinerary Builder: This tool enables both guests and staff to plan and manage personalized itineraries, incorporating real-time availability from integrated partners like OpenTable and Book4Time. Revenue Management: UrVenue offers dynamic pricing and yield management tools to optimize revenue across different experiences and time slots. Analytics and Insights: The platform provides detailed analytics to help venues understand guest behavior, optimize operations, and drive repeat business and customer loyalty.     Redefining Leadership in Hospitality with Noelle Labrie

    What does it take to build cohesive teams and foster strong leadership in the fast-paced world of hospitality? In this episode, I’m joined by Noelle Labrie, a leadership development expert who knows firsthand the unique challenges restaurant operators face. From high turnover and inconsistent service to the struggle of developing managers while juggling daily operations, she’s seen it all—and she’s created a solution. Noelle Labrie’s career in hospitality has taken her across the world – from Latin America to Hawaii to the Middle East. Previously, Noelle Labrie held the position of Regional Training Manager for P.F. Chang’s, where she opened more than 20 new restaurants in the Southwestern United States and Hawaii. She also oversaw the opening of P.F.Chang’s first international location in Mexico City as well as two other new restaurants in two brand-new countries for the chain in Latin America. While at P.F. Chang’s, Noelle oversaw the training programs for more than 30 restaurants. She also led training and operational teams for 25 food brands, ranging from luxury dining to food retail in Kuwait during her time with the Alshaya Group.  In all of her previous roles, she implemented training programs for every level of staff, including new and existing employees as well as the training managers under her. A leader of leaders, Noelle Labrie became a solopreneur and opened her consultancy, Tri-Skill Consulting, in 2023. Today, she draws on her experience in the hospitality field to customize restaurant-specific training programs and help General Managers, Area Leaders, and Directors feel confident in their teams and their culture.  In this episode, we talk about how targeted leadership development can reduce costs, improve morale, and foster a strong culture in any hospitality business.
